From 665fd82860080c8d23baa51bd4add037c70d3f76 Mon Sep 17 00:00:00 2001 From: Levi Neuwirth Date: Tue, 14 Jul 2026 17:45:09 +0100 Subject: [PATCH] =?UTF-8?q?fix(highlight):=20PR=20#118=20round=201=20?= =?UTF-8?q?=E2=80=94=20drop=20locals-predicate=20captures;=20stale=20comme?= =?UTF-8?q?nts?= M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it [P2] The shared JavaScript highlights query guards its builtin captures (console, require, …) with `#is-not? local`, a PROPERTY predicate (`Query::property_predicates`) that needs a scope map from the grammar's LOCALS_QUERY — which pmacs does not run. `compute_highlight_spans` took every capture, so a locally-shadowed `console`/`require` still surfaced as `@variable.builtin`/`@function.builtin`; a theme distinguishing `.builtin` would mis-style the shadowed local. Full locals processing is substrate work; conservatively fail-closed instead: drop captures whose pattern carries an `#is?`/`#is-not? local` property predicate (the identifier falls back to its non-builtin capture). The text predicates (`#eq?`/`#match?`/`#any-of?`, already applied by the capture iterator) and `#set!` settings are untouched. This is a general engine fix — it corrects the same latent mis-styling for any grammar using the locals predicate, not just JS/TS. - javascript_shadowed_builtin_is_not_mislabeled: a local `const console` produces no `*.builtin` capture (directly observed to fail — two `variable.builtin` captures — before the fix).
